Northern California Coast Dentist
Full Time | Outpatient Dentistry | Northern California Coast
Heartline Staffing, in partnership with Purple Cow Recruiting, is hiring a dentist in Fortuna, California. Position overview includes a mission-driven outpatient dental opportunity serving pediatric and adult populations along California's Northern Coast. Join a collaborative, team-based dental environment focused on high-quality patient care and strong clinical support. Practice comprehensive dentistry with mentorship, integrated workflows, and access to specialty resources.
Why this opportunity stands out:
- Base compensation up to $225,000 annually
- $15,000 sign-on bonus
- Up to $20,000 relocation assistance available
- NHSC and federal loan repayment eligibility ranging from $75,000 to $300,000
- $5,000 annual professional expense card including licensing, DEA, CE, equipment, and custom-fitted loupes
- Flexible scheduling options including 5x8 or 4x10 shifts
- Six-month mentorship and onboarding support
- Practice in a scenic Northern California coastal community near redwood forests and the Pacific coastline
Schedule and practice model:
- Outpatient-only dental practice
- Monday through Friday schedule
- 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M or four 10-hour shifts available
- Team-based clinical support structure
- Integrated care and quality-focused environment
Clinical responsibilities:
- Provide comprehensive general dentistry services to pediatric and adult patients
- Perform restorative procedures, extractions, and routine dental care
- Handle routine and complex procedures including molars and extractions
- Collaborate closely with dental assistants, hygienists, and support staff
- Refer complex pediatric cases internally as needed
- Participate in quality improvement and team-based care initiatives
Compensation and benefits:
- Base salary: $183,000 – $225,000 annually
- $15,000 sign-on bonus
- $10,000 relocation reimbursement
- Additional $10,000 relocation support for qualifying family relocation
- 29 days paid time off including CME, holidays, and sick time
-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ance
- NHSC and federal loan repayment eligibility
- $5,000 annual professional expense card for licensing, DEA, CE, and equipment
- Laptop and cell phone provided
- Spanish language differential pay available
Requirements:
- DDS or DMD required
- Active California dental license or ability to obtain required
- Comfortable treating both pediatric and adult patient populations required
- Experience with extractions and complex procedures preferred
- Mission-driven approach to community healthcare required
- Team-based and collaborative clinical mindset required
- Commitment to underserved populations strongly preferred
